2. Key Advantages of Steel in Construction
The advantages of steel in construction are manifold, beginning with its exceptional strength-to-weight ratio. Steel allows for the creation of large open spaces without the need for excessive internal supports. This design flexibility is particularly appealing for commercial buildings such as shopping centers, factories, and warehouses. Additionally, steel structures are inherently resilient, capable of withstanding harsh environmental conditions, such as high winds and earthquakes. The fabrication process of steel structures is also streamlined, permitting quicker assembly on site, which translates to faster project completion times.
Another notable benefit of steel construction is its uniformity and reliability. Unlike wooden structures that can warp, crack, or decay, steel components are manufactured to precise specifications, ensuring consistent quality. Moreover, compliance with international standards, such as AWS D1.1 for welding, and EN1090-2 for execution of structural steelwork, further reinforces the structural integrity and safety of steel buildings. As a result, construction companies can assure clients of the resilience and longevity of their projects.
3. Durability and Longevity of Steel Structures
One of the most compelling advantages of steel structures is their durability. Steel is inherently resistant to many forms of deterioration, including rot, mold, and insect damage, which are often significant concerns in traditional wooden structures. This durability translates to a longer lifespan; steel structures can easily last over 50 years with minimal maintenance. Consequently, this longevity reduces the need for frequent repairs or replacements, offering significant savings over time.
Furthermore, the durability of steel structures enhances their ability to withstand adverse weather conditions. Steel can handle extreme temperatures and is non-combustible, making it a safer choice in regions prone to wildfires. This resilience extends not only to natural disasters but also to everyday wear and tear, which allows businesses to maintain their operational integrity over decades without costly overhauls. Steel’s impressive performance in this regard further underscores its value as a preferred construction material.
4. Cost-Efficiency and Economical Aspects
Cost efficiency is a critical factor for businesses considering various materials for construction. While the initial cost of steel can sometimes be higher than that of wood or concrete, its long-term economic benefits far outweigh these initial expenditures. The speed of construction enabled by pre-fabricated steel components can significantly reduce labor costs and project timelines, allowing businesses to launch their operations sooner. This aspect is particularly beneficial in the competitive market where time equates to revenue.
Moreover, steel structures often result in lower overall maintenance costs. Their durability means they require less frequent repairs, which can further alleviate financial strain over the life of the building. The recyclability of steel also contributes to cost savings. When a structure reaches the end of its life, steel can be 100% recycled, offering businesses an economical and environmentally friendly option for disposal. This circular economy aspect of steel construction reinforces its appeal for modern businesses aiming to optimize costs while minimizing environmental impact.
